Castor Oil and Baking Soda

Ingredients:
1 spoon castor oil
1 spoon baking soda
Method:
Make a paste by mixing both the ingredients together,
Wash your face well and pat dry, Apply the mix on the affected areas of your skin.
Leave on for 5-10 minutes and rinse off.
Practice this once everyday since baking soda has anti-inflammatory properties which help soothe the acne and dries out breakouts.
Castor Oil and Turmeric

Ingredients:
1 spoon turmeric
1/2 spoon castor oil
Method:
Mix the ingredients to form a paste.
Wash your face and apply the paste on affected areas.
Wash after 15 minutes.
Practice this once a day since turmeric contains antiseptic properties and helps in eradicating acne causing bacteria.
